CVE-2023-41058

Always-Incorrect Control Flow Implementation in npm/parse-server

Identifiers

CVE-2023-41058, GHSA-fcv6-fg5r-jm9q

Package Slug

npm/parse-server

Vulnerability

Always-Incorrect Control Flow Implementation

Description

Parse Server is an open source backend server. In affected versions the Parse Cloud trigger beforeFind is not invoked in certain conditions of Parse.Query. This can pose a vulnerability for deployments where the beforeFind trigger is used as a security layer to modify the incoming query. The vulnerability has been fixed by refactoring the internal query pipeline for a more concise code structure and implementing a patch to ensure the beforeFind trigger is invoked. This fix was introduced in commit be4c7e23c6 and has been included in releases 6.2.2 and 5.5.5. Users are advised to upgrade. Users unable to upgrade should make use of parse server's security layers to manage access levels with Class-Level Permissions and Object-Level Access Control that should be used instead of custom security layers in Cloud Code triggers.

Affected Versions

All versions starting from 1.0.0 before 5.5.5, all versions starting from 6.0.0 before 6.2.2

Solution

Upgrade to versions 5.5.5, 6.2.2 or above.
